
“The meeting of the county board of infirmary directors held Monday was marked by the retirement of David Stewart, and the assuming of office by the new member, George A. Ditty. The other members were re-elected. The board organized by electing James McJunkin , president; George A. Ditty, vice president, and William Weidner, secretary.”
“John Hall was re-elected as superintendent of the institution for another year. He has made a most capable official.”
“The meeting was held at the institution on the west side, and a fine spread was served to the members of the board, newspaper men, and the thirty-nine inmates at the meal hour.”
“The report of the board submitted shows that eighty-nine inmates were cared for at the infirmary during the year a number in excess of former years, but with the crops enabled them to feed the institution for less money.”
